General Service Medal, GVI, bar Malaya, 1953 Coronation Medal, L.A.C. Geoffrey Douglas Boniface, Royal Air Force, an RAF Bandsman. 

 

Officially engraved: “3116616 L.A.C. G.D. Boniface. R.A.F.”

 

Swing mounted as worn on original ribbons.

 

1953 Coronation confirmed on the medal roll, which shows him present with the “No 5 Regional Band” RAF.

 

Geoffrey Douglas Boniface was born in Chertsey Surrey during April 1930.

 

Local wartime newspapers in Surrey recall a young Musician named “Geoffrey Boniface” described as “The Boy Wonder on the Xylophone and Accordion”. He is mentioned a few times working various events.
